W.A. Clarkson is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, W.A. Clarkson has authored 207 papers receiving a total of 6.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 190 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 154 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 10 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in W.A. Clarkson’s work include Solid State Laser Technologies (117 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(117 papers) and Photonic Crystal and Fiber Optics (104 papers). W.A. Clarkson is often cited by papers focused on Solid State Laser Technologies (117 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(117 papers) and Photonic Crystal and Fiber Optics (104 papers). W.A. Clarkson coll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and United States. W.A. Clarkson's co-authors include Johan Nilsson, David J. Richardson, D.C. Hanna, J. K. Sahu, Deyuan Shen, J.W. Kim, J. M. O. Daniel, P.W. Turner, P.J. Hardman and J. I. Mackenzie and has published in prestigious journals such as Optics Letters, Optics Express and Journal of Physics D Applied Physics.
